INTEREST– Labor Code §4603.2&3150; Interest does not apply to the situation in which an employer or defendant is seeking reimbursement from another employer or defendant for medical expenses paid prior to a judgment determining contribution rights. Salinas Rural Fire Protection District v. Workers' Compensation Appeals Board (Walter Days) 4 WCAB Rptr. 10,109

INTEREST– Labor Code §5800– If the Appeals Board rescinded the WCJ's award, the right to interest which existed pursuant to the award would terminate pursuant to Labor Code §5800. (See Myers v. Workers' Comp. Appeals Bd. (1969) 2 Cal.App.3d 621.) Gloria Cobb v. Workers' Compensation Appeals Board, Alta Bates Hospital. 3 WCAB Rptr. 10,077
